Small Office Design (200-500 sq ft)
The available space in compact offices becomes more functional when combined with appropriate furniture and effective organisational systems. The project investment requirements range from ₹1,20,000 to ₹4,50,000, depending on which finish quality the customer chooses.
- Workstation Setup (₹40,000-₹1,20,000): The workstation setup costs range from ₹40,000 to ₹1,20,000. Users can rearrange their workspaces with modular desks at workstations, priced between ₹8,000 and ₹18,000 per unit. Investing ₹4,000-10,000 per ergonomic chair provides employees with comfort while protecting their long-term health.
- Storage Solutions (₹20,000-₹60,000): The storage area maximizes floor space utilization with vertical filing cabinets, wall-mounted shelving, and multipurpose storage units. Ready-made options at ₹3,000-12,000 per unit offer better value than custom carpentry for low-budget small office interior design.
- Meeting Areas (₹25,000-₹80,000): The budget for Meeting Areas is ₹25,000-₹80,000. The space includes 4-6 conference tables with 4 -6 chairs each, providing effective discussion areas.
- Reception Zone (₹30,000 and ₹90,000): This cost covers establishing a basic reception area with a branded backdrop to generate positive initial impressions among visitors. Comfortable waiting seating for 2-4 guests, basic amenities, and a complete professional entry area.
- Lighting and Atmosphere (₹15,000-₹45,000): Good lighting creates an environment that enhances the workspace's overall quality. The cost of LED panels for lighting fixtures ranges between ₹800 and ₹2,000 per unit.
Medium Office Spaces (500-1,000 sq ft)
Larger offices support departmental zones and more comprehensive low-budget office creative small office interior design while maintaining cost consciousness.
- Multiple Workstations (₹80,000-₹2,00,000): The price range for multiple workstations extends from ₹80,000 to ₹2,00,000. The system accommodates 8 to 15 staff members through its modular design.
- Dedicated Meeting Room (₹60,000-₹1,50,000): This meeting room includes a table and seating for 6-10 people, and presentation equipment and acoustic treatment. The office's soundproofing system preserves client privacy by blocking external noise.
- Break Area (₹40,000-₹1,00,000): The area includes seating zones and a food storage section, creating a peaceful workplace for staff. The two main functions of employee amenities include improving job satisfaction and creative thinking, and providing staff members with essential time to rest from their regular duties.
- The Manager Cabin (₹50,000-₹1,20,000): This cabin features a glass-partitioned private office that allows staff to work independently while keeping the area open to others. Installing glass partitions at ₹200-400 per square foot provides professional space division while avoiding the need to build solid walls.

Quick Service / Cafe Design (400-700 sq ft)

Fast-casual concepts provide customers with fast service while maintaining control over customer flow through their facilities. The investment requirements range from ₹2,80,000 to ₹6,30,000 to support both operational activities and counter service operations.
- Counter and Service Area (₹60,000-₹1,50,000): The space includes a working service counter with a display case and dedicated areas for POS system operations and food preparation. The main customer contact area requires significant financial backing because it serves as the organisation's central point of customer interaction.
- Limited Seating (₹40,000-₹1,20,000): The venue offers limited seating at prices ranging from ₹40,000 to ₹1,20,000. The venue provides tables and chairs for 10 to 20 guests, at a cost of ₹2,500 to ₹5,000 per seat. A mix of 2- and 4-seater tables offers flexible seating capacity for low-budget restaurant interior design.
- Kitchen Setup (₹1,00,000-₹2,50,000): Establishing a small commercial kitchen requires an investment of ₹1,00,000-₹2,50,000, covering all necessary equipment, preparation areas, and storage facilities. The restaurant should focus on providing dependable service rather than high-end amenities, as this approach will maintain both excellent food and quick service.
- Branding Elements (₹30,000-₹80,000): Menu boards, wall graphics, signage, and decorative elements that support the concept. A strong visual identity system can make up for limited store space by creating enduring customer memories through the shopping experience.
- Lighting Design (₹25,000-₹60,000): The design of multiple lighting layers creates an attractive environment at a cost of ₹25,000-₹60,000. The design elements in this low-budget restaurant are highlighted by pendant lights above the counter, ambient lighting, and strategic accent features.
Casual Dining Restaurant (700-1,200 sq ft)

Full-service restaurants require a comprehensive design supporting comfortable dining experiences. Budget ₹6,30,000 to ₹13,20,000 for the complete setup.
- Dining Area Seating (₹1,20,000-₹3,20,000): The venue offers seating for 30 to 50 guests, with a mix of chairs and tables providing comfortable support. The dining area should combine different seating options, including booths, regular tables, and bar stools, to create multiple dining areas within one room.
- Kitchen and Prep (₹2,00,000-₹5,00,000): The kitchen and prep area requires an investment of ₹2,00,000 to ₹5,00,000. The space needs to include a complete commercial kitchen with multiple work areas, adequate cooling and ventilation systems, and optimised operational routes. Quality equipment enables organisations to prevent operational failures that could disrupt service delivery to customers.
- Bar/Beverage Counter (₹80,000-₹2,00,000): Display area, bar seating, and beverage preparation zone, if applicable. This feature is a focal point that deserves design attention, even in a low-budget restaurant interior design.
- Restroom Facilities (₹60,000-₹1,50,000): The bathroom area must remain clean and functional, as it reflects the overall quality of the establishment. Most concepts require basic sanitary equipment, which should be placed in well-lit areas with proper ventilation to support hygiene practices.
- Themed Decor (₹50,000-₹1,50,000): The themed decor section costs between ₹50,000 and ₹1,50,000 and includes all props, artwork, wall treatments, and decorative elements that help bring the concept to life. Organisations can reduce expenses by adopting new sourcing methods that enable them to create authentic customer experiences through their own content production.
- Flooring and Finishes (₹60,000-₹1,80,000): The total cost for flooring and finishes ranges between ₹60,000 and ₹1,80,000. The building features vitrified tiles or commercial vinyl as its durable and easy-to-clean flooring material. User safety depends on the product's anti-slip characteristics. Wall treatments that are coordinated with one another create a unified design.

Small Shop Design (200-400 sq ft)
The design of small retail spaces enables customers to see products while they move through the store. The basic setup requires a budget of ₹1,20,000- ₹3,60,000.
- Display Solutions (₹40,000-₹1,20,000): Wall-mounted shelving, display tables, and product showcases. The modular system allows users to adjust their configuration as their inventory changes, enabling seasonal product management.
- Counter and Storage (₹30,000-₹80,000): The price range for Counter and Storage equipment spans from ₹30,000 to ₹80,000. The system includes a checkout counter with a billing section and storage facilities behind the counter.
- Lighting (₹20,000-₹60,000): The cost range for lighting fixtures in this project is ₹20,000-₹60,000. The combination of track lighting, spotlights, and general illumination creates attractive product displays that stay visible throughout the entire space.
- Branding Elements (₹15,000-₹50,000): These elements, priced between ₹15,000 and ₹50,000, include signage, window graphics, and brand colours that work together to create a unified identity. The store attracts customers through visually appealing displays that simultaneously convey the brand identity to interested buyers.
- Trial/Service Area (₹15,000-₹50,000): The trial/service area costs between ₹15,000 and ₹50,000 to create fitting rooms, consultation spaces, and service counters based on product requirements. Customers' comfort level during the consideration phase determines how many will eventually make a purchase.
Cost-Effective Material Choices

Businesses choose strategic materials because they reduce costs while maintaining a professional look and extending product life, supporting their operations.
Flooring for Commercial Spaces
Choosing the right flooring is crucial for commercial spaces, balancing durability, maintenance, and aesthetics. Options such as vitrified tiles, commercial vinyl, and polished concrete offer cost-effective solutions for offices, restaurants, and retail environments while supporting creative, low-budget interior designs.
- Vitrified Tiles (₹50-90 per sq ft): Extremely durable and low-maintenance. A wide variety, including wood-look and stone-look options suitable for offices, restaurants, and shops. Excellent for low-budget offices and creative small-office interior design.
- Commercial Vinyl (₹60-120 per sq ft): Comfortable, quieter than tiles, and waterproof. Quick installation reduces labor costs. Available in countless patterns, matching any design concept for low budget restaurant design.
- Polished Concrete (₹40-80 per sq ft): Industrial aesthetic popular in modern spaces. Extremely durable and low-maintenance. A cost-effective option that creates a contemporary look in offices and casual restaurants.
Wall Treatments
Wall treatments define the look and feel of commercial spaces while staying budget-friendly. Options like paint, panels, and exposed finishes offer style, durability, and easy maintenance for offices and restaurants.
- Paint (₹18-35 per sq ft): Most economical with unlimited colour possibilities. Accent walls create visual interest. Washable paints suit commercial environments requiring frequent cleaning in low budget restaurant interior design.
- Wall Panels (₹100-250 per sq ft): PVC or WPC Wall panels add texture and dimension. Easy installation and maintenance make them practical for a wide range of commercial applications.
- Exposed Finishes: Leaving brick, concrete, or structural elements visible creates an industrial aesthetic at zero cost. Popular in modern offices and restaurants, turning budget constraints into stylistic features.
Furniture Solutions
Smart furniture choices combine durability, versatility, and cost-efficiency. Ready-made, mixed-material, and multi-purpose pieces optimise space and style for small offices and budget-conscious commercial interiors.
- Ready-Made Commercial Furniture: Durable pieces designed for heavy use cost 30-50% less than custom fabrication. Standardised dimensions suit most commercial spaces in low budget small office interior design.
- Metal and Laminate Combinations: Contemporary furniture mixing materials costs less than solid wood. Industrial-style pieces suit both office and restaurant applications effectively.
- Multi-Purpose Pieces: Furniture serving multiple functions maximises investment value. Convertible tables, nesting chairs, and modular seating offer flexibility essential for dynamic commercial spaces.

Regulatory Compliance Requirements

Commercial buildings must comply with all applicable building codes, fire safety regulations, and industry-specific accessibility standards and requirements. Organisations need to allocate compliance budgets because non-compliance will result in costly penalties.
Fire safety equipment, including extinguishers and alarms; emergency exits that are properly illuminated and accessible; accessible facilities for disabled customers; and sufficient ventilation that complies with health regulations must be considered essential investments.
The design process requires local authorities to verify all required specifications before the execution phase begins. Business operations are disrupted when violations lead to financial penalties, facility shutdowns, and costly equipment modifications.
